MastodonStartpage/docker/files/binit.sh

20 rivejä
464 B
Bash
Executable file

#!/bin/sh
predown() {
echo -e "\nStoppo tutto..."
echo "Stoppo apache..."
httpd -k stop
echo "Stoppo mysqld (pid: $mysqld_pid)..."
kill $mysqld_pid
exit 0
}
trap 'predown' HUP INT QUIT TERM
echo "Lancio mysqld..."
/usr/bin/mysqld --basedir=/usr --datadir=/var/lib/mysql --plugin-dir=/usr/lib/mariadb/plugin --user=mysql --log-error=/var/lib/mysql/mysql.err --pid-file=mysql.pid &> /dev/null &
mysqld_pid=$!
echo "Lancio apache..."
httpd -k start
wait $!